Giants drop Jaguars for fourth straight win: Here’s how Twitter reacted

The New York Giants headed down to Jacksonville riding a three-game winning streak headed into their matchup against the Jaguars.

It was a game that was filled with sloppy play and plenty of drops by the Giants receivers, and struggles to stop the Jaguars running game.

The Giants also suffered a few big injuries on the day including Evan Neal, Daniel Bellinger and Ben Bredeson. The team also lost cornerback Adoree’ Jackson for a short amount of time in the fourth quarter

The Giants trailed 17-13 in the fourth when they came up with a massive stop on fourth-and-1 on a quarterback sneak by Trevor Lawrence at the Giants’ 20-yard line. The stop gave the Giants the ball with 11:30 left in the game.

On the ensuing drive, the Giants would drive down the field and Daniel Jones would score on a quarterback sneak to conclude a 10-play, 79-yard drive.

The Jaguars would go three-and-out on the following drive and the Giants burn some clock before concluding the drive with a 34-yard field goal that was partially blocked but went through the uprights to give the Giants a six-point lead.

On the Jaguars’ final drive, they would get to the Giants red zone due to a fourth-and-15 conversion. The play would have an extra 15 yards tacked on due to a questionable Leonard Williams roughing the passer call.

The game would end on a pass to Christian Kirk who was stopped close to the goal line and brought down as time expired.

The Giants would hold on in a dramatic ending to improve to 6-1 on the season and extend their winning streak to four straight games.
